2024-25 Wrestling Roster
Scott, Jayden

Jayden Scott
- Weight:
- 141
- Class:
- Redshirt Sophomore
- Hometown:
- Henrietta, N.Y.
- High School:
- Rush-Henrietta
Bio
2024-25: Competed at 141 pounds during third season as a Tar Heel • Collected 15 wins during the season • Opened the campaign with four wins at the 141-pound title at the Southeast Open (11/2) • Earned first dual win of the season versus Drexel's Jordan Soriano (11/9) • Secured four-straight wins to begin Southern Scuffle (1/4-1/5) • Collected three consecutive ACC wins against Duke's Christian Colman (1/17), NC State's Tyler Tracy (1/31) and Pitt's Anthony Santaniello (2/7) • Represented the Tar Heels at the 2025 ACC Championships at Duke (3/9) • Earned two wins at the conference tournament • Collected the No. 29 seed for the 2025 NCAA Championships in Philadelphia • Went 1-2 at the national tournament, defeating No. 13 Todd Carter of Gardner-Webb
2023-24: Competed at 149 pounds during redshirt-freshman season • Secured 19 victories throughout the year • Began the campaign with a first period fall against Riley Curran of Queens at the Carolina Duals (11/2) • Defeated Buffalo's Kaleb Burgess by decision at WrangleMania (11/11) • Had two-straight decisions at the Cliff Keen Las Vegas Invitational (12/1) • Recorded back-to-back dual wins over Morgan State (12/16) and Appalachian State (12/17) • Recorded two decisions and a major decision at Soldier Salute (12/29) • Earned four wins at the Appalachian Open (1/27) • Finished the regular season with three-straight ACC dual wins • Represented the Tar Heels at the 2024 ACC Championships as the No. 3 seed • Had a major decision and sudden victory decision at the ACC Championships (3/10) • Named to the All-Academic Academic Team • Named to the ACC Academic Honor Roll
2022-23: Competed at 149 pounds during true freshman campaign in Chapel Hill • Collected 14 victories during first college season • Made collegiate debut for the Tar Heels at the Southeast Open (11/5) • Earned three-straight decisions at the Southeast Open to begin college career • Defeated Campbell's Callum Sitek at the Battle at Bragg (11/11) • Earned a decision over Cornell's Gage McClenahan at the Collegiate Wrestling Duals in New Orleans (12/20) • Claimed five wins on way to a runner-up finish at the F&M Open (1/6) • Went 4-0 at the Appalachian State Open to secure the 149 pound title (1/28) • Saw action in first ACC dual against Pitt's Tyler Badgett (2/3)

Year | Overall | Dual | ACC | MD | TF | Fall |
22-23 | 14-6 | 2-3 | 0-1 | - | 1 | 1 |
23-24 | 19-13 | 8-4 | 3-1 | 2 | 3 | 1 |
24-25 | 15-14 | 4-9 | 3-3 | 2 | 1 | - |
Career | 48-33 | 14-16 | 6-5 | 4 | 5 | 2 |
